from __future__ import annotations
import argparse
import asyncio
import json
import os
import zipfile
from pathlib import Path
from typing import Any
import httpx
from core.config import get_settings
from scripts.app.import_road_infrastructure import (
_load_records,
_normalize_record,
import_records,
)
def _resolve_manifest_path(path: str | None) -> Path:
if path:
return Path(path).resolve()
return Path(__file__).resolve().with_name('road_sources.example.json')
def _pick_extract_member(source: dict[str, Any], archive: zipfile.ZipFile) -> str:
configured = source.get('extract_member')
if configured:
return str(configured)
candidates = [
member
for member in archive.namelist()
if member.lower().endswith(('.csv', '.json', '.geojson'))
]
if not candidates:
raise ValueError(f'Archive for {source["name"]} does not contain CSV/JSON/GeoJSON data')
return candidates[0]
async def _download_source(source: dict[str, Any], settings) -> Path:
url = source.get('url')
if not url:
local_path = source.get('path')
if not local_path:
raise ValueError(f'Source "{source["name"]}" must define either "path" or "url"')
return Path(local_path).resolve()
headers = {'User-Agent': settings.http_user_agent}
params = dict(source.get('query_params') or {})
api_key_env = source.get('api_key_env')
api_key_param = source.get('api_key_param')
api_key_header = source.get('api_key_header')
api_key = os.getenv(api_key_env) if api_key_env else settings.data_gov_api_key
if api_key:
if api_key_param:
params[api_key_param] = api_key
if api_key_header:
headers[api_key_header] = api_key
target_dir = settings.data_dir / 'official_downloads'
target_dir.mkdir(parents=True, exist_ok=True)
target_path = target_dir / f'{source["name"]}{Path(url).suffix or ".dat"}'
async with httpx.AsyncClient(
timeout=max(settings.request_timeout_seconds, 60),
headers=headers,
follow_redirects=True,
) as client:
response = await client.get(url, params=params)
response.raise_for_status()
target_path.write_bytes(response.content)
return target_path
async def _materialize_source(source: dict[str, Any], settings) -> Path:
downloaded = await _download_source(source, settings)
if downloaded.suffix.lower() != '.zip':
return downloaded
with zipfile.ZipFile(downloaded) as archive:
member = _pick_extract_member(source, archive)
target_dir = settings.data_dir / 'official_downloads' / source['name']
target_dir.mkdir(parents=True, exist_ok=True)
archive.extract(member, path=target_dir)
return (target_dir / member).resolve()
async def _import_source(source: dict[str, Any], settings) -> tuple[int, int]:
input_path = await _materialize_source(source, settings)
fmt = source.get('format', 'auto')
raw_records = _load_records(input_path, fmt)
records = []
skipped = 0
source_prefix = source['name'] # e.g. 'pmgsy_rural_roads'
for index, raw_record in enumerate(raw_records, start=1):
try:
record = _normalize_record(
raw_record,
default_state_code=source.get('default_state_code'),
default_project_source=source.get('default_project_source') or source['name'],
default_data_source_url=source.get('default_data_source_url') or source.get('url'),
index=index,
)
# Prefix road_id with source name to guarantee global uniqueness.
# e.g. 'MDR201' (repeats across states) -> 'pmgsy_rural_roads-MDR201-5'
record.road_id = f'{source_prefix}-{record.road_id}-{index}'
records.append(record)
except Exception as exc:
skipped += 1
print(f'[{source["name"]}] Skipping row {index}: {exc}')
print(f'[{source["name"]}] Normalized {len(records)} records, importing in batches...')
imported = await import_records(records)
return imported, skipped
async def main() -> None:
parser = argparse.ArgumentParser(
description='Download and import official road infrastructure datasets using a manifest file.',
)
parser.add_argument(
'--manifest',
help='Path to a JSON manifest describing official road datasets to import.',
)
args = parser.parse_args()
settings = get_settings()
manifest_path = _resolve_manifest_path(args.manifest)
if not manifest_path.exists():
raise SystemExit(f'Manifest not found: {manifest_path}')
sources = json.loads(manifest_path.read_text(encoding='utf-8'))
if not isinstance(sources, list):
raise SystemExit('Manifest must contain a JSON array of source definitions')
total_imported = 0
total_skipped = 0
for source in sources:
imported, skipped = await _import_source(source, settings)
total_imported += imported
total_skipped += skipped
print(f'[{source["name"]}] imported={imported} skipped={skipped}')
print(f'Official road import complete. imported={total_imported} skipped={total_skipped}')
if __name__ == '__main__':
asyncio.run(main())
